加入收藏 在線留言 聯系我們
關注微信
手機掃一掃 立刻聯系商家
全國服務熱線19867371424
公司新聞
線上題庫刷題課程學習教育系統APP專業定制開發
發布時間: 2024-10-09 11:55 更新時間: 2024-11-01 09:00

線上題庫刷題課程學習教育系統APP的開發是一個綜合性的過程,涉及多個模塊和功能的實現。以下是一個基本的開發方案:

一、用戶端功能
  1. 注冊與登錄

  2. 手機號/郵箱注冊:用戶可以通過輸入手機號或郵箱進行注冊,設置密碼并完成驗證后即可登錄系統。

  3. 第三方登錄:支持微信、QQ等第三方平臺快速登錄。

  4. 題庫瀏覽

  5. 科目分類:按照不同的學科對題庫進行分類,方便用戶查找。

  6. 難度篩選:提供簡單、中等、困難等不同難度的題目篩選功能。

  7. 搜索功能:通過關鍵詞搜索題目或題庫。

  8. 刷題練習

  9. 在線答題:用戶可以在線選擇題目進行作答,系統實時保存答案。

  10. 自動批改:對于選擇題等客觀題,系統可以自動批改并給出正確答案和解析。

  11. 手動批改:對于主觀題,需要教師或助教進行手動批改。

  12. 查看解析

  13. 答案解析:每道題目都配有詳細的答案和解析,幫助用戶理解知識點。

  14. 視頻講解:部分難題或重點題目提供視頻講解,加深用戶理解。

  15. 學習記錄

  16. 刷題記錄:記錄用戶的刷題歷史,包括題目、答案、得分等信息。

  17. 進度追蹤:展示用戶的學習進度和成就,激勵用戶持續學習。

  18. 課程購買

  19. 課程瀏覽:展示可購買的課程列表,包括課程名稱、價格、簡介等信息。

  20. 在線支付:支持多種支付方式(如支付寶、微信支付)進行課程購買。

  21. 課程學習:購買后的課程可以在“我的課程”中查看和學習。

  22. 討論交流

  23. 討論區:用戶可以在討論區發表帖子,與其他用戶交流學習心得。

  24. 私信功能:支持用戶之間的私信溝通,方便答疑解惑。

二、后臺管理功能
  1. 題庫管理

  2. 題目添加:管理員可以添加新的題目,設置題目內容、答案、解析等信息。

  3. 題目編輯:對已有題目進行修改,更新題目內容或答案。

  4. 題目刪除:刪除不再需要的題目。

  5. 課程管理

  6. 課程發布:管理員可以發布新的課程,設置課程信息和價格。

  7. 課程編輯:對已發布的課程進行修改,更新課程內容或價格。

  8. 課程下架:將不再售賣的課程下架處理。

  9. 用戶管理

  10. 用戶信息查看:查看用戶的基本信息和學習記錄。

  11. 用戶禁用:對于違規用戶進行禁用處理。

  12. 數據統計

  13. 用戶統計:統計注冊用戶數量、活躍用戶數量等信息。

  14. 訂單統計:統計課程購買數量、銷售額等信息。

  15. 學習統計:統計用戶的學習時長、刷題數量、正確率等數據。

三、技術實現
  1. 前端技術:采用React Native或Flutter等跨平臺框架開發iOS和Android雙端應用。

  2. 后端技術:使用Node.js、Express.js搭建服務器,MongoDB或MySQL作為數據庫存儲數據。

  3. 第三方服務:集成支付接口(如支付寶、微信支付)用于課程購買,以及推送服務用于消息通知。

四、注意事項
  1. 安全性:確保用戶數據的安全,采用加密存儲和傳輸。

  2. 性能優化:對系統進行性能測試和優化,確保在高并發情況下仍能穩定運行。

  3. 用戶體驗:注重用戶體驗的設計,提高系統的易用性和響應速度。

  4. 可擴展性:考慮系統的可擴展性,為未來可能的功能擴展留出接口。


產品分類

聯系方式

  • 電  話:19867371424
  • 經理:潘經理
  • 手  機:19867371424
  • 微  信:glrj0668